在群晖NAS上搭建Clash的详细指南

引言

在现代网络环境中,科学上网已成为许多用户的需求。Clash作为一款强大的代理工具,能够帮助用户实现这一目标。本文将详细介绍如何在群晖NAS上搭建Clash,包括安装步骤、配置方法以及常见问题解答。

什么是Clash?

Clash是一款支持多种代理协议的代理工具,具有以下特点:

  • 多协议支持:支持Vmess、Shadowsocks、HTTP等多种协议。
  • 规则配置:用户可以根据需求自定义规则,灵活控制流量。
  • 高性能:Clash在性能上表现优异,能够满足大多数用户的需求。

群晖NAS简介

群晖NAS是一款功能强大的网络附加存储设备,广泛应用于家庭和企业。其主要特点包括:

  • 数据存储:提供大容量的数据存储解决方案。
  • 应用扩展:支持多种应用程序的安装和使用。
  • 远程访问:用户可以通过互联网远程访问存储在NAS上的数据。

在群晖NAS上搭建Clash的准备工作

在开始搭建Clash之前,用户需要做好以下准备:

  • 群晖NAS设备:确保设备正常运行,并已连接到互联网。
  • Docker安装:Clash将通过Docker容器运行,因此需要在群晖上安装Docker。
  • Clash配置文件:准备好Clash的配置文件,通常为YAML格式。

安装Docker

  1. 登录群晖NAS的管理界面。
  2. 打开“套件中心”。
  3. 搜索“Docker”,并点击安装。
  4. 安装完成后,打开Docker应用。

在Docker中安装Clash

  1. 在Docker应用中,点击“注册表”。
  2. 搜索“clash”,选择合适的镜像(如“dreamacro/clash”)。
  3. 右键点击镜像,选择“下载”。
  4. 下载完成后,点击“映像”,找到下载的Clash镜像,右键选择“启动”。
  5. 在弹出的窗口中,配置容器设置,包括端口映射和环境变量。
  6. 点击“应用”,完成容器的创建。

配置Clash

  1. 进入Clash容器的设置界面,找到配置文件的路径。
  2. 将准备好的YAML配置文件上传到该路径。
  3. 在Clash的设置中,确保代理规则和服务器信息正确无误。
  4. 启动Clash容器,检查日志以确认是否正常运行。

测试Clash是否成功搭建

  1. 在本地设备上配置代理,指向群晖NAS的IP地址和Clash的端口。
  2. 访问被墙的网站,检查是否能够正常访问。
  3. 如果无法访问,检查Clash的日志,排查问题。

常见问题解答

1. 如何更新Clash的配置文件?

  • 通过Docker界面进入Clash容器,替换旧的YAML配置文件为新的文件,重启容器即可。

2. Clash支持哪些代理协议?

  • Clash支持Vmess、Shadowsocks、HTTP、SOCKS等多种协议,用户可以根据需求选择。

3. 如何查看Clash的运行日志?

  • 在Docker界面中,选择Clash容器,点击“日志”选项卡即可查看运行日志。

4. 如果Clash无法正常工作,应该如何排查?

  • 检查配置文件是否正确,确保端口映射无误,查看运行日志以获取错误信息。

结论

通过以上步骤,用户可以在群晖NAS上成功搭建Clash,实现科学上网的需求。希望本文能够帮助到需要的用户,享受更自由的网络体验。

正文完
 0